Porch Ramp Construction Questions
What types of porches are suitable for ramp installation? Ramps can be added to various porch types, including concrete, wood, or brick, to improve accessibility and safety.
How is the height of the ramp determined? The height is measured from the ground to the porch level, ensuring the ramp provides a gentle incline for easy access.
What materials are used for porch ramps? Common materials include wood, aluminum, and composite, chosen for durability and suitability to the existing porch structure.
Are ramps customizable to fit different property layouts? Yes, ramps can be designed to match the specific dimensions and layout of a property for optimal accessibility.
